A Beginner's Guide to Spider-Man Comics
So, you're ready to dive into the incredible world of Spider-Man books? Fantastic! It can seem a little intimidating at first, with decades of history to explore. A good first point is understanding the fundamental concept: Peter Parker, a teenage student, gains incredible abilities after being exposed by a mutated spider. From there, he becomes Spider-Man, a protector battling villains in New York City. Don’t worry about understanding everything at once; jump in with classic storylines like "Amazing Fantasy #15" (his debut) or later runs by creators like Stan Lee and John Romita Sr. – these writers will give you a strong grasp of the hero and his universe.
Spider-Man: How the Character Has Evolved
The remarkable web-slinger, Spider-Man, has undergone a major evolution since his appearance in 1962. Initially portrayed as a conventional teenager battling ordinary villains, he has matured into a layered figure grappling with deep internal struggles and universal responsibilities. Early versions often focused on traditional adventure sequences, while later iterations have copyrightined his emotional condition, connection with kin, and the moral effects of his talents. This ongoing reinterpretation ensures Spider-Man remains contemporary and interesting for new audiences.
